The Headwaters of the San Marcos

River: Spring Lake

Fed by springs that bubble up from the Edwards Aquifer below-

pumping at a rate of 130 million gallons per day.

Purchased by the University in 1994, is now The Meadows Center for

Water and the Environment.

San Marcos River is home to 8 endangered and threatened species.

Spring Lake is thought to be one of the longest continually inhabited

sites in North America with artifacts dating back 12,000 years.

Time for Class

16

A beloved symbol of life on the hill, the

College Bell once sat near Old Main

and signaled class changes from the

early 1940’s to the mid 1960’s. (Now

on display in the Veteran’s memorial

garden.)

The Bell Tower was built in the

1970s. It chimes daily at noon,

and it plays “Alma Mater” and

“Go Bobcats” on

commencement days.

For Luck…

18

Rub the Bobcat

Victory Ball for luck

and personal success.

It’s located near the

end-zone complex at

Bobcat Stadium.

Rub the Fighting Stallions

for luck before exams.

Located on the Quad near

Derrick Hall. This is also

the university’s designated

free speech area.
